Position Summary


The Department of Political Science at the University of Detroit Mercy invites
applications for
a tenure-track position at the rank of Assistant Professor in Political Science, with specialization in Legal Studies or
Judicial Politics,
to begin August 2026.

The Department of
Political Science
and its Pre-Law
program are vibrant with engaged faculty committed to offering innovative courses and programming for our growing student population that is
fervent and eager to learn. The Department of Political Science is deeply committed to the University’s distinctive mission of educational
excellence, to a diverse student population within a vibrant urban context, and a commitment to community engagement. The Department of
Political Science is dedicated to enhancing diversity in the University community and curriculum.



The department seeks candidates to
teach courses in Legal Studies and Judicial Studies broadly construed. Teaching assignments may include the following areas: Supreme Court,
American Political Institutions, Contract Law, Property Law, Family Law, Torts, Law and Culture, Arbitration and Mediation/Alternative
Dispute Settlement, and Law and Society. Candidates should be prepared to teach various Political Science courses in addition to topics in
their area of specialization. The teaching load is 18 credit hours (6 courses) per academic year for faculty with an active research agenda.
The successful candidate will assume directorship of the Pre-Law Program. In addition, the candidate will be expected to participate in
professional development activities related to teaching and student advising. The candidate will be expected to engage in research and
scholarship related to political science, legal or judicial studies, and to provide service to the department and its pre-law program, and
to the College and University.

Requirements

Minimum Qualifications



1. A Ph.D.
in
Political Science. Advanced ABDs will be considered but must have their Ph.D. in Political Science completed within one year of hire.


2. Demonstrated excellence in undergraduate teaching (teaching evaluations) and a commitment to experiential learning.



3.
Evidence of active engagement with research and scholarship demonstrated by presentations at conferences, publications, moot court
participation, or membership in professional organizations.

Preferred Qualifications



Candidates with a Ph.D.
in Political Science who also have a JD are preferred and encouraged to apply. Candidates with experience in directing a pre-law program, or
other demonstrated service or leadership are preferred. A track record of research achievement including a current research plan in
Political Science, Legal Studies or Judicial Studies is preferred. We are especially interested in applicants dedicated to excellence in
both teaching and research in a liberal arts setting. Strong candidates will have a record of experience or demonstrated commitment to
teaching diverse students.
